Military Strength:
Burundi vs
Uganda
Uganda (ranked #89 globally) holds a stronger overall military position than Burundi (#125) on the ATLAS Index. Burundi fields 31,000 active troops vs 46,000 for Uganda, backed by 10,000 reserves and 1,400 paramilitary. Uganda's $1.3B defense budget is 12:1 that of Burundi ($0.1B).

Key figures
| Burundi | Uganda | Ratio |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Defense budget | $108M | $1.3B | 🇺🇬 12× |
| – share of GDP | 3.5% | 2.0% | 🇧🇮 1.8× |
| Active personnel | 31,000 | 46,000 | 🇺🇬 1.5× |
| Combat aircraft | 0 | 6 | 🇺🇬 |
| Warships | 0 | 0 | — |
| – submarines | 0 | 0 | — |
| Main battle tanks | 10 | 240 | 🇺🇬 24× |
| Nuclear warheads | 0 | 0 | — |

| Reserve troops | 0 | 10,000 | 🇺🇬 |
| Paramilitary forces | 21,000 | 1,400 | 🇧🇮 15× |
| Military aircraft (all types) | 13 | 51 | 🇺🇬 3.9× |
| – helicopters | 13 | 30 | 🇺🇬 2.3× |
| Budget share of govt spending | — | 9.0% | 🇺🇬 |
| Budget per capita | $8 | $26 | 🇺🇬 3.3× |
| Population | 14M | 50M | 🇺🇬 3.6× |
| GDP | $3.1B | $54B | 🇺🇬 17× |
| GDP per capita | $219 | $1,078 | 🇺🇬 4.9× |
| Land area | 25,680 km² | 197,100 km² | 🇺🇬 7.7× |
| Coastline | 0 km | 0 km | — |
